What is a Reverse Mortgage?
A reverse mortgage is a type of loan designed for homeowners aged 62 or older, allowing them to convert a portion of their home equity into cash without the need to sell their home or make monthly mortgage payments. This financial tool, often referred to as home equity conversion, enables eligible individuals to access funds that can supplement retirement income, cover daily expenses, or fund home improvements.
At its core, home equity conversion works by leveraging the value of your home. Instead of making payments to a lender, you receive money based on your home's appraised value, your age, and current interest rates. Benefits of Reverse Mortgages in 92067
Reverse mortgages offer several advantages for elderly residents in the 92067 zip code, providing financial flexibility and the ability to age in place while staying in their own homes. For instance, these loans allow you to convert home equity into usable funds without the need for monthly mortgage payments, as long as you maintain your property taxes, insurance, and upkeep. One of the key benefits is the flexibility in how you receive your funds, such as a cash lump sum or regular monthly payments, which can be tailored to your specific needs. This can help cover various expenses, making it easier to manage retirement budgets. Moreover, reverse mortgages often come with potential tax advantages, as the proceeds are generally not considered taxable income, allowing you to use these funds to help with living expenses like healthcare, home improvements, or daily costs without increasing your tax burden.
